Pickup and Travel

Your day begins with pickup from your centrally located Prague hotel, outside the pedestrian zone, in a sleek Renault minivan. The drive to Kutná Hora takes about 80 minutes—a comfortable journey that sets the tone for a stress-free day. During the ride, your guide shares insights into the region’s history and points out interesting sights along the route. Reviewers often praise the smooth, air-conditioned ride, making it a nice transition from Prague’s hustle to the quieter Czech countryside.

Sedlec Ossuary (Bone Church)

Your first stop is the Sedlec Ossuary, famous for its artistically arranged bones and macabre charm. A guided 25-minute tour takes you inside this small chapel decorated with skulls, bones, and a large chandelier—all assembled with artistic flair. One reviewer mentioned, “The bones are surprisingly beautiful in their own creepy way,” highlighting how this site balances its eerie reputation with a haunting beauty that sticks with you.

Cathedral of the Assumption in Sedlec

Next, visit the Cathedral of the Assumption of Our Lady and St. John the Baptist. This 15-minute guided tour reveals the church’s Gothic architecture and history. It’s a peaceful space that contrasts with the Bone Church’s quirky appeal, offering a moment of reflection on the spiritual side of Kutná Hora. Many appreciate the concise but informative tour, which makes the visit feel meaningful without feeling rushed.

St. Barbara’s Church

The highlight for many is St. Barbara’s Gothic Church, often described as a masterpiece of late Gothic architecture. With a guided 30-minute tour, you’ll explore its stunning vaults, intricate stained glass, and impressive altar. Several reviews mention the “breathtaking views” and how the detailed craftsmanship makes it a must-see. The church’s commanding presence gives you a real sense of the wealth and importance Kutná Hora once held as a silver mining town.

Medieval Streets & Key Sights

Following the churches, you’ll stroll through charming medieval streets dotted with quaint shops, cafes, and historical buildings like the Jesuit College and Italian Court. These sites add depth to your understanding of Kutná Hora’s vibrant past. A few reviewers note the narrow cobbled streets can be uneven, so good shoes are essential.

Optional Silver Mine Tour

For those craving something extra, the optional silver mine tour offers a subterranean adventure. Note that advance booking is required and depends on ticket availability. Several travelers found this addition “totally worth it,” as it gives a rare glimpse into the underground workings of medieval miners. The tour involves some walking and possibly bending, so be prepared for a physically modest but memorable experience.

Practical Details and Tips

Kutná Hora: Private Day Trip with Silver Mine Option - Practical Details and Tips

Transportation: The private, air-conditioned minivan provides a comfortable, quiet environment for the entire trip, which is especially appreciated after a busy day of sightseeing.

Timing: The tour lasts between 6 to 8 hours, with starting times varying based on availability. It’s best to check the schedule in advance, especially if you want to combine the silver mine visit.

Walking: Expect about 3 hours of walking, on uneven, historic pavement. Good shoes are a must, especially if you want to maximize your comfort.

Inclusions & Extras: Admission to the ossuary and churches is covered, and the silver mine visit is included if booked in advance. Bottled water is provided, adding to the overall value.

What to Bring: Comfortable shoes, a camera, and a sense of adventure. Since food isn’t included, consider packing a light snack or plan to enjoy a local lunch in Kutná Hora.

Restrictions: The tour isn’t wheelchair accessible, and smoking or eating in the vehicle isn’t allowed.
